Designing for Success: SEO Tips Every Web Designer Should Know
As a web designer, your role extends beyond creating visually appealing and user-friendly websites. To truly succeed in the digital landscape, you need to consider the visibility and discoverability of the websites you design. Search engine optimization (SEO) plays a pivotal role in achieving this goal. In this blog post, we'll explore the importance of SEO for web designers and provide essential tips to optimize your web designs for search engines.
The SEO-Web Design Connection
Search engines like Google use complex algorithms to rank websites in search results. While content quality and backlinks play significant roles in SEO, the design and structure of a website also have a substantial impact on search engine rankings. Here's why SEO is crucial for web designers:
- Improved Visibility: SEO ensures that your websites are more likely to appear in search engine results pages (SERPs). This increased visibility can drive organic traffic to your designs.
- Enhanced User Experience: SEO-friendly design practices often align with user experience (UX) principles. A well-structured, user-friendly website tends to rank better in search results and provides a better experience for visitors.
- Competitive Edge: Websites that incorporate SEO best practices are more likely to outperform competitors in search rankings, potentially attracting more clients and projects.
SEO Tips for Web Designers
- Mobile-Friendly Design: With mobile-first indexing by search engines, it's crucial to create responsive, mobile-friendly designs. Test your designs on various devices to ensure they look and perform well on all screen sizes.
- Fast Loading Times: Optimize images and use efficient coding practices to reduce page load times. Faster-loading websites tend to rank higher in search results.
- Clean and Semantic HTML: Use clean and semantically structured HTML to enhance website accessibility and search engine readability. Proper use of headings (H1, H2, etc.) and meaningful HTML tags can improve SEO.
- Structured Data Markup: Implement structured data (Schema.org markup) to provide search engines with additional information about your content. This can result in rich snippets in search results, enhancing click-through rates.
- Optimize Images: Compress and properly tag images using descriptive alt text and file names. This improves both SEO and accessibility.
- Readable URLs: Create user-friendly and descriptive URLs that reflect the content's topic. Avoid using generic or random strings of characters.
- XML Sitemaps: Include XML sitemaps to help search engines understand the structure and hierarchy of your website. This makes it easier for search engines to index your pages.
- Internal Linking: Implement an effective internal linking strategy to connect related content on your website. This enhances user navigation and helps search engines discover and index more of your content.
- Page Speed Optimization: Minimize HTTP requests, use browser caching, and enable compression to improve page speed. Google considers page speed a ranking factor.
- Optimize for Core Web Vitals: Pay attention to Google's Core Web Vitals, which assess user experience factors such as loading performance, interactivity, and visual stability. Design with these metrics in mind.
- Keyword Research: Collaborate with content creators to conduct keyword research. Incorporate relevant keywords into your design elements, such as headings, meta titles, and meta descriptions.
- SEO-Friendly URLs: Create SEO-friendly URLs that reflect the content's topic and hierarchy. Avoid using lengthy or cryptic URLs.
By integrating these SEO principles into your web design process, you can create websites that not only look great but also perform well in search engine rankings. Ultimately, this leads to increased visibility, more traffic, and greater success for your clients and your web design career.